I was reading a link that was provided in one of the other threads here, the link is to this doc Information Bridge: DOE Scientific and Technical Information - Sponsored by OSTI In the doc there is one paragraph that mentions the Prius engine has a supercharger , huh?? First I have heard of this. 2.2.1 Engine The design of the 1.5-liter engine in the 2004 Prius is based on the Atkinson Cycle in which compression stroke and expansion stroke duration can be set independently. A supercharger is used with the engine to increase its output. I did not see any other reference to this in the doc, or anywhere else.
No supercharger in the Prius. It's called a Miller Cycle when you pair an Atkinson Cycle ICE with a supercharger.
